Job Description

Summary Objective

The City Attorney's Office is seeking an individual with oral advocacy, legal writing, organization skills, and who exhibits enthusiasm, judgment, intelligence, and legal ability to effectively represent the interests of the City of Riviera Beach.

  • Assists the City Attorney as legal counsel for the City in all municipal areas.
  • Prepares written legal opinions and renders legal advice to City Council, boards, committees and City departments.
  • Reviews, drafts and approves ordinances, charter amendments, resolutions, contracts, deeds, leases, permits licenses and other legal documents.
  • Interprets federal, state, county and City statutes, ordinances, charters, rules, regulations, court decisions, etc.
  • Confers with and renders assistance to City departments in establishing departmental policies by developing and applying legal points and procedures; recommends changes in policies and procedures in order to meet legal requirements.
  • Attends meetings of the City Council, boards and committees to advise on legal matters.
  • Conducts legal research as needed.
  • Analyzes and reports proposed and enacted legislation.
  • Maintains professional contact with other agencies as applicable.
  • Performs other related duties as required.

Minimum Qualifications

Juris Doctorate from an accredited law school and four (4) years of professional paid legal experience, which three (3) years must have been in government law or areas of law relating to or involving government law issues.

A valid Class-E driver's license is required at the time of appointment. Membership in the Florida Bar at the time of application is required.
